Q:

Your network consists of a single Active Directory domain that contains two domain controllers. Both domain controllers run Windows Server 2003 Service Pack 2 (SP2). Auditing of successful account logon events is enabled on all computers in the domain. You need to identify the last time a specific user logged on to the domain. What should you do?

A) Examine the System Event Log on the user's computer. B) Examine the System Event Log on both domain controllers.
C) Examine the Security Event Log on both domain controllers. D) Examine the Application Event Log on the user's computer.
 
Answer & Explanation Answer: C) Examine the Security Event Log on both domain controllers.

Q:

Your network consists of a single Active Directory domain. All servers run Windows Server 2003 Service Pack 2 (SP2). You enable auditing for failed logon attempts on all domain controllers. You need to ensure that a record of failed logon attempts is retained for 90 days on all domain controllers. What should you do?

A) From the Security Templates snap in, open the hisecdc template. Modify the Retain System Log setting. B) From the Security Templates snap in, open the securedc template. Modify the Retain Security Log setting.
C) Open the Default Domain Policy. Modify the Retain System Log setting. D) Open the Default Domain Controller Policy. Modify the Retain Security Log setting.
 
Answer & Explanation Answer: D) Open the Default Domain Controller Policy. Modify the Retain Security Log setting.

Q:

Your network consists of a single Active Directory domain. The domain includes a group named SalesUsers. You have a file server that runs Windows Server 2003 Service Pack 2 (SP2). The server has a folder named CorpData. You share the CorpData folder and assign the Domain Users group the Full Control share permission. In the CorpData folder, you create a folder named Sales. You need to configure security for the Sales folder to meet the following requirements: -Members of the SalesUsers group must be able to read, create, and modify all files and folders. -All other users must be able to view items in the folder. What should you do?

A) On the Sales folder, block permission inheritance and remove permissions. Assign the Allow Modify permission to the SalesUsers group. B) On the Sales folder, block permission inheritance and copy permissions. On the Sales folder, assign the Allow Modify permission to the SalesUsers group.
C) On the CorpData share, change the share permission for Domain Users to Read. On the Sales folder, assign the Allow Modify permissions to the SalesUsers group. D) On the CorpData folder, block permission inheritance and remove permissions. In the Sales folder, assign the Allow Modify permissions to the SalesUsers group.
 
Answer & Explanation Answer: B) On the Sales folder, block permission inheritance and copy permissions. On the Sales folder, assign the Allow Modify permission to the SalesUsers group.

Q:

You are experiences problems when starting Word 2010. The software just keeps on crashing and never fully loads. Your colleague has recommended that you start Word in a particular mode. What could this be?

A) Safe Mode B) Private Mode
C) Easy Mode D) Invulnerable mode
 
Answer & Explanation Answer: A) Safe Mode

Q:

Word 2010 has a particular template that it uses when you first open the program. This template contains default styles, no text and you also use it when you create new, blank documents. As you customize styles, marcos and other elements these settings are automatically stored in this template.

 

What is the name of this template file?

A) Standard.dotx B) Normal.dotx
C) Empty.dotx D) Template.dotx
 
Answer & Explanation Answer: B) Normal.dotx
